I came accross quite a fantastic word - Puffery ! 
In everyday language, puffery refers to exaggerated or false praise, in law it can mean a promotional statement or claim that expresses subjective rather than objective views. 
Puffery serves to puff up an exaggerated image of what or whom is being .

A rather good explainantion below of  - Pseudoarcheology 
This is presented as pseudoscience focused on the study or promotion of archaeology in ways which do not meet the basic standards of the scientific method. Pseudoarcheology can often involvs the study of real archaeological objects such as Eygpt, Stonehenge, but ascribes alleged mystical powers or supernatural/paranormal origins to them. Belief in ancient astronauts, or in mythological locations such as Atlantis, are sometimes part of pseudoarcheology.
